Does Salesforce Support VoIP Calling?

Salesforce with VOIP Integrations

Salesforce doesn’t offer built-in VoIP calling, but it fully supports VoIP integrations via its AppExchange. Businesses can choose from a wide range of VoIP providers that plug directly into Salesforce, allowing users to:

  • Initiate calls directly from contact records using click-to-call features
  • Automatically log call outcomes, durations, notes, and recordings
  • Enable real-time AI features such as call transcription and sentiment detection
  • Track rep performance and customer satisfaction within the CRM

These integrations make Salesforce more than a CRM — they turn it into a full-fledged communication hub. Tools like FreJun enhance this ecosystem with powerful automation and analytics, giving your sales and support teams everything they need in one interface.

Why Businesses Need VoIP Integration with Salesforce

VOIP and salesforce integration benefits

The modern sales process is about timing, relevance, and follow-through. Integrating a VoIP system with Salesforce eliminates manual processes, reduces delays, and creates a tighter feedback loop between calls and CRM workflows.

Here’s why it matters:

  • Real-Time Personalization: Reps can instantly view a customer’s history before making a call.
  • Improved Data Accuracy: Call logs, notes, and transcripts are auto-synced into Salesforce.
  • Better Lead Response Times: With click-to-call and call automation, follow-ups happen faster.
  • Comprehensive Reporting: Monitor KPIs like call success rates, missed calls, and resolution times.
  • Enhanced Customer Experience: Contextual communication leads to more empathetic service.

In short, VoIP integration empowers your team to spend less time on admin and more time closing deals and solving problems.

2. RingCentral – Reliable and Enterprise-Ready

RingCentral

RingCentral is known for its unified communication suite and strong integration with Salesforce. It’s great for enterprises needing scalable infrastructure. The platform integrates seamlessly with productivity tools like Microsoft Teams and Salesforce, making it an excellent choice for enterprises looking to streamline communication. With its focus on reliability and scalability, RingCentral caters to businesses of all sizes, from startups to global corporations.

Key Features:

  • Embedded calling from Salesforce interface
  • Smart call routing and IVR setup
  • Voicemail transcription and call summaries
  • Integrated video conferencing

Pricing:  The basic plan starts at $30/user/month.

G2 Rating: 4/5

3. 8×8 – Global Reach with AI Insights

8*8

8×8 supports global teams with a communication suite that connects voice, video, and messaging with Salesforce data. It is designed to provide businesses with comprehensive communication tools, combining VoIP, video conferencing, and team messaging. It stands out with its global reach, offering unlimited calls to over 40 countries and advanced analytics for customer engagement. The platform’s scalability makes it a great choice for both small businesses and large enterprises looking for a reliable, feature-rich solution.

Key Features:

  • Omnichannel communication
  • Real-time voice transcription
  • Click-to-dial with auto-logging
  • Smart call analytics and reports

Pricing: 8×8 offers flexible pricing plans starting at $24 per user per month.

G2 Ratings: 4/5

4. Aircall – Lightweight, Fast, and Effective

Aircall

Aircall is built for small to mid-size teams and offers simple, fast integration with Salesforce. It focuses on improving customer communication, offering a platform designed for sales and support teams. Its features include real-time call monitoring, customizable IVR, and seamless CRM integration.

Key Features:

  • Call pop-ups with contact information
  • Automatic call logging and CRM tagging
  • Real-time coaching and whisper features
  • Power dialer for outbound campaigns

Pricing: The basic plan starts at $30/user/month.

G2 Rating: 4.3/5

5. Dialpad – AI at the Core

Dialpad

Dialpad brings voice intelligence to your sales team with real-time coaching, live transcription, and sentiment analysis. Dialpad’s intuitive design and advanced features cater to businesses aiming to improve productivity and customer satisfaction. Dialpad is an AI-powered VoIP solution known for its real-time voice intelligence and transcriptions.

Key Features:

  • Call summaries and action item tracking
  • Integration with Salesforce activities
  • Visual voicemail and tagging
  • Mobile-friendly design for remote teams

Pricing: The basic plan starts at $27/user/month.

G2 Rating: 4.4/5

Pro Tip

If you’re struggling with adoption post-integration, create a quick training playbook for your team. Include screenshots of how to make calls, where to see call notes, and how to tag interactions. Empowering your team to use the new VoIP inside Salesforce will multiply your ROI.
